In this complexly-plotted action-packed police drama, Pittsburgh policewoman Keri Finnegan (Linda Kozlowski) returns to her home turf to clean up crime and clear the ruined name of her father, a cop who was wrongfully disgraced and fired from the force. McKees Rocks is one Steeltown's roughest ethnic neighborhoods, and though many residents are impoverished, they have yet to surrender their pride. Keri's father's reputation, plus her gender, make it very difficult for her to do her job. When a serial killer begins slaughtering owners of local property, Keri masquerades as an old woman and is attacked by what appears to be a policeman. He is eventually arrested for killing his wife, but for some reason the cops ignore the other killings. Keri, however, doesn't and thus launches her own investigation. She finds herself opposed at every turn, not only by her lover and fellow-detective Nick Donovan (John Shea), but also by the police chief, Nick's father, and a powerful gangster. ~ Sandra Brennan, All Movie Guide

In this black comedy, elderly Jack Scanlan (Jack Warden) passes away just as he's about to tell his oldest son Johnny (Bob Hoskins) what he's decided is truly important in life, which does little to ease Johnny's mid-life anxieties. Jack's funeral and the subsequent wake brings together the various members of the Scanlan Family, most of whom are having troubles of their own. Johnny's mother Mary (Maureen Stapleton) is not dealing well with losing her husband. His brother Frank (William Petersen), a would-be union delegate, has a nagging wife, Denise (Debra Rush), and a pregnant daughter, Rachel (Teri Polo). His sister Nora (Frances McDormand) is a leftist nun who has brought along a guest, a South American dissident wanted by the INS. Terry (Pamela Reed) is splitting up with her husband Boyd (Tim Curry) after finally realizing that he's gay. And Johnny is thinking of quitting his job and leaving his wife Amy (Blair Brown), which makes the mysterious Cassie (Nancy Travis) seem all the more attractive. Passed Away marked the directorial debut of successful screenwriter Charlie Peters. ~ Mark Deming, All Movie Guide

Susan Sarandon and Nick Nolte give brilliant performances as parents trying to save the life of their son in George Miller's harrowing and heartbreaking Lorenzo's Oil. Based on a true story, the film begins as bright young Lorenzo (Zack O'Malley Greenburg) is leading a pleasant life on the Comoro Islands. But things start to go wrong with him -- he collapses, he raves, and he loses his hearing -- so his concerned parents, Augusto (Nick Nolte) and Michaela Odone (Susan Sarandon), take him to a doctor. The diagnosis is a death warrant; they are told that Lorenzo has been diagnosed with adrenoleukodystrophy (ALD), an rare and incurable nerve disease that is always fatal. When Augusto and Michaela are told to be patient as they watch their son sink further into the debilitating illness, they take matters into their own hands and start their own investigation of the disease. Using rapeseed oil, they find their own treatment for ALD. ~ Paul Brenner, All Movie Guide
